Why the introduction of visas with Russia will turn into a disaster for Ukraine

The introduction of visas with the Russian Federation will result in a humanitarian disaster for Ukraine, since it will require significant funds to ensure the work of consular offices. Political scientist Vsevolod Stepanyuk stated this at a press conference in Kyiv. According to the expert, this step by the Ukrainian authorities has nothing to do with national security, a PolitNavigator correspondent reports. The introduction of visas with Russia will be a crazy blow to Ukrainian migrant workers

The introduction of a visa regime with Russia, discussed in the Verkhovna Rada, may lead to retaliatory measures from Moscow, which will hit Ukrainian migrant workers. TV presenter Vyacheslav Pikhovshek stated this on the NewsOne TV channel, a PolitNavigator correspondent reports. Kuchma said that the visa regime with Russia is absurd

Former President of Ukraine Leonid Kuchma, now representing Ukraine at the negotiations in Minsk, considers the initiative to introduce visas with the Russian Federation absurd. Turchynov regretted that Klimkin’s department is trying to protect the interests of Ukrainians in the Russian Federation

Secretary of the National Security and Defense Council of Ukraine Oleksandr Turchynov believes that Ukraine should introduce a visa regime with Russia for security reasons. The Ukrainian parliament did not support the visa regime with Russia

Kyiv, June 04 (Navigator, Mikhail Ryabov) - The Verkhovna Rada on Tuesday refused to include on the agenda the initiative of the Svoboda party - a draft appeal to the government with a proposal to denounce the agreement with Russia on a visa-free regime. The project was supported by only 127 deputies instead of the required 226.
